Brawn 'excited' by promising aerodynamic research work
Ross Brawn says he is "quite excited" by the initial results from the aerodynamic research work conducted by his team as it works to define F1's future regulation platform. F1's sporting manager has put together a team of specialists to improve the understanding and impact of aerodynamics in Formula 1. Brawn's technical department, headed by former Williams aero chief Jason Sommerville, has acquired Manor's 2017 model while teams have agreed to supply the unit with confidential CFD data to help with its work and analysis.
